7 U.S.C. § 364 - Repealed. Aug. 11, 1955, ch. 790, § 2, 69 Stat. 675

Notes

Section, act Mar. 2, 1889, ch. 373, 25 Stat. 840, required all agricultural experiment stations to devote a portion of their work to the examination and classification of the soils of their respective States and Territories.

Statutory Notes and Related Subsidiaries

Existing Rights and LiabilitiesAny rights or liabilities existing under this section as unaffected by repeal, see section 2 of act Aug. 11, 1955, set out as a note under former section 361 of this title.
